Abstract
本实用新型公开了一种用于避雷器的接线杆,包括杆身、固装在杆身顶端的杆体、设置在杆体一侧的钳形夹头、细杆,细杆一端设有插线孔,该细杆的另一端与杆体通过螺纹连接,位于杆体上的细杆和钳形夹头彼此相对;钳形夹头的下颚长于上颚,该钳形夹头整体为C形。本实用新型采用钳形夹头,工作时将试验引线设置在细杆的插线孔上,再通过避雷器的均压环对钳形夹头下颚的按压,使接线杆夹住或松开避雷器均压环。本实用新型的接线方式替代了斗臂车和人力配合的接线方式,接线时间1分钟,大大缩短接线时间,提高工作效率。
The utility model discloses a connecting rod used for lightning arresters, which comprises a rod body, a rod body fixed on the top of the rod body, a pincer chuck arranged on one side of the rod body, and a thin rod. One end of the thin rod is provided with a wire insertion hole. The other end of the thin rod is threadedly connected with the rod body, and the thin rod on the rod body and the pliers chuck are opposite to each other; the lower jaw of the pliers chuck is longer than the upper jaw, and the pliers chuck is C-shaped as a whole. The utility model adopts a pincer chuck. When working, set the test lead wire on the wire insertion hole of the thin rod, and then press the lower jaw of the pincer chuck through the pressure equalizing ring of the lightning arrester, so that the terminal rod clamps or loosens the lightning arrester. pressure ring. The wiring mode of the utility model replaces the wiring mode of bucket arm truck and manpower cooperation, and the wiring time is 1 minute, which greatly shortens the wiring time and improves the work efficiency.

背景技术 Background technique
110kV及以上电压等级带均压环的避雷器属于户外设备,此类型避雷器一般安放位置较高,在进行避雷器高压试验时,经常花费大量时间、使用大量人力物力,降低了工作效率。在遇到有风天气时,试验引线经常会被刮落,为试验人员及设备带来很大的安全隐患。 110kV and above surge arresters with grading rings are outdoor equipment. This type of arrester is generally placed at a relatively high position. When conducting high-voltage tests on arresters, it often takes a lot of time, manpower and material resources, which reduces work efficiency. When encountering windy weather, the test leads are often scraped off, which brings great safety hazards to test personnel and equipment. the
目前采用在避雷器均压环上挂接试验引线的方式,进行高压试验接线,在实际工作中发现存在以下缺点: At present, the method of hanging the test lead wire on the pressure grading ring of the arrester is used to carry out the high-voltage test wiring, and the following shortcomings are found in actual work:
1、避雷器均压环安放位置较高,试验引线挂接不方便,需借助斗臂车完成。 1. The voltage equalizing ring of the surge arrester is placed at a high position, and it is inconvenient to connect the test lead wires, so it needs to be completed by means of a bucket arm truck. the
2、斗臂车占地面积大、臂长,与带电设备距离不易保持足够的安全距离。 2. The bucket arm truck occupies a large area and has a long arm, so it is difficult to maintain a sufficient safety distance from the live equipment. the
3、操作斗臂车耗时长,监护、指挥、操作等人员投入多。 3. It takes a long time to operate the bucket arm truck, and the personnel involved in monitoring, commanding, and operating etc. invest a lot. the
4、避雷器均压环处所接的试验引线易受外力影响,遇有风天气,试验引线易被刮落,严重威胁到试验人员的安全。 4. The test leads connected to the pressure grading ring of the arrester are easily affected by external forces. In windy weather, the test leads are easily scraped off, which seriously threatens the safety of test personnel. the
现有的试验引线挂取不便,连接不牢固,对试验过程带来不便,对试验数据造成影响,易受外界影响,严重威胁人身及设备安全。 The existing test lead wires are inconvenient to hang, and the connection is not firm, which brings inconvenience to the test process, affects the test data, is easily affected by the outside world, and seriously threatens the safety of people and equipment. the
